Old Fashioned Glasses

Glossary of Terms

An old fashioned glass (also known as a lowball glass, rocks glass or whiskey glass) is a type of tumbler with a short, straight sided design usually with a heavyweight base. It typically holds between 4oz and 8oz and is most commonly used for serving spirits and liqueurs on the rocks, such as whiskey and Scotch. An old fashioned tumbler may also be used for serving water, juice or short cocktails.
